Mount Kenya Climbing Expeditions & Routes
The Mount Kenya trek is a challenging and enjoyable journey to Mount Kenya’s highest trekking peak (Point Lenana) at 4985 metres. From the summit there is a beautiful view of the dramatic volcanic massif and the two main peaks of Batian and Nelion, as well as long views over the central plains of Kenya. It has long been a popular and very attractive hike through an ancient landscape dotted with glaciers, rock spires, high tarns and some beautiful unique flora and fauna like the giant groundsels and the odd looking rock hyrax which has evolved from the elephant.

Great Migration
Over one million blue wildebeest, accompanied by 200,000 zebras and a variety of other antelope species, engage in an annual circular migration through the Masai Mara and Serengeti in pursuit of appropriate grazing grounds.
Mount Kenya Trek
Mount Kenya ranks as the second tallest mountain in Africa and is classified as an ancient extinct volcano. The mountain is home to 12 remaining glaciers, all of which are retreating swiftly, along with four secondary peaks
Bird Watching
Kenya's varied ecosystems, changing climate, and extensive regions of protected wilderness foster an extraordinary biodiversity, accommodating more than 1,100 species, including many endemic species and a diverse array of migratory birds that arrive each year.
